Genflow Biosciences Business Description

Other Exchanges GENF:UKWQ5:Germany
Address 6 Heddon Street, London, GBR, W1B 4BT
Genflow Biosciences PLC is a preclinical biotechnology company focused on the development of biological interventions (namely gene therapies) which are aimed at tackling the effects of aging, potentially slowing or halting the aging process and so reducing the incidence of age-related diseases and thereby increasing health span. Its flagship compound, GF-1002, is based on the delivery of a variant of the SIRT6 gene and is currently in preclinical development.
